bat 定义一组元素strs[2]
时间: 2023-09-22 18:05:43 浏览: 42
在 `bat` 中定义数组可以通过 `set` 命令实现。如果要定义一个名为 `strs` 的数组,并赋值元素 `"element1"` 和 `"element2"`,可以使用以下语法:
```
set strs[0]=element1
set strs[1]=element2
```
其中,`strs` 是数组名,`[0]`、`[1]` 是数组索引,`element1`、`element2` 是对应索引的值。
这样就定义了一个名为 `strs` 的数组,包含两个元素 `"element1"` 和 `"element2"`,分别对应索引 `0` 和 `1`。如果要访问这些元素,可以使用以下语法:
```
echo %strs[0]%
echo %strs[1]%
```
其中,`%strs[0]%` 和 `%strs[1]%` 分别代表数组 `strs` 中的第一个元素和第二个元素。
相关问题
bat 定义strs[2] 中元素了
在 `bat` 脚本中,定义数组可以通过 `set` 命令实现。如果要定义一个名为 `strs` 的数组,可以使用以下语法:
```
set strs[0]=element0
set strs[1]=element1
set strs[2]=element2
...
```
其中,`strs` 是数组名,`[0]`、`[1]`、`[2]` 等是数组索引,`element0`、`element1`、`element2` 等是对应索引的值。
因此,如果要定义 `strs[2]` 中的元素,可以使用以下语法:
```
set strs[2]=element2
```
其中,`element2` 是要赋给 `strs[2]` 的元素的值。
bat 定义字符串数组
在 C++ 中,可以使用以下语法来定义字符串数组:
```c++
#include <iostream>
#include <string>
using namespace std;
int main() {
string strs[3] = {"hello", "world", "!"};
for(int i = 0; i < 3; i++) {
cout << strs[i] << endl;
}
return 0;
}
```
这里定义了一个包含三个字符串的字符串数组 `strs`,并且用大括号 `{}` 初始化了数组中的每个元素。在输出时,可以使用循环遍历整个数组并输出每个字符串。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)